The Documentation Specialist is designated as Key Personnel under the IT System Administration and Operational Core Services contract. This role is responsible for creating, managing, and maintaining high-quality documentation that supports IT operations, business processes, and survey data entry requirements. The Documentation Specialist ensures accuracy, compliance, and usability of documentation across system administration, infrastructure, business support systems, and data entry functions, thereby enabling efficiency, transparency, and continuity of operations.
Develop, maintain, and update technical and operational documentation for IT environments, including systems configurations, processes, and procedures.
Document workflows, policies, and best practices for:
System administration (Linux, Windows, VMware, M365, cloud environments).
ServiceNow administration, workflows, and integrations.
Help Desk processes, customer support SOPs, and end-user knowledge base articles.
Data entry/keypunching processes for survey operations.
Produce and maintain contract deliverables (e.g., Weekly Status Reports, Monthly Status Reports, progress meeting notes, implementation plans, and knowledge transfer materials).
Ensure all documentation is clear, consistent, accurate, and compliant with federal and standards.
Maintain and publish user guides, training materials, and reference documentation for IT systems and survey workflows.
Support quality assurance by reviewing documentation for completeness and compliance with contract and COR requirements.
Collaborate with program staff, IT administrators, and contractors to gather information and translate technical details into user-friendly documentation.
Track version control, maintain documentation repositories, and safeguard contractor-produced materials (Government property).
